Description

This security bulletin contains information about 6 vulnerabilities.


1) Improper Authentication (CVE-ID: CVE-2023-35137)

CWE-ID: CWE-287 - Improper Authentication

CVSSv4: CVSS:4.0/AV:N/AC:L/AT:N/PR:N/UI:N/VC:H/VI:N/VA:N/SC:N/SI:N/SA:N/E:U/U:Green


The vulnerability allows a remote attacker to bypass authentication process.

The vulnerability exists due to an error in when processing authentication requests in the authentication module. A remote attacker can send a specially crafted URL to the target device and obtain system information.


2) OS Command Injection (CVE-ID: CVE-2023-35138)

CWE-ID: CWE-78 - Improper Neutralization of Special Elements used in an OS Command ('OS Command Injection')

CVSSv4: CVSS:4.0/AV:N/AC:L/AT:N/PR:N/UI:N/VC:H/VI:H/VA:H/SC:N/SI:N/SA:N/E:U/U:Amber


The vulnerability allows a remote attacker to execute arbitrary shell commands on the target system.

The vulnerability exists due to improper input validation in the "show_zysync_server_contents" function. A remote unauthenticated attacker can pass specially crafted data to the application and execute arbitrary OS commands on the target system.

Successful exploitation of this vulnerability may result in complete compromise of vulnerable system.


3) Improper Neutralization of Special Elements in Output Used by a Downstream Component (CVE-ID: CVE-2023-37927)

CWE-ID: CWE-74 - Improper Neutralization of Special Elements in Output Used by a Downstream Component ('Injection')

CVSSv4: CVSS:4.0/AV:N/AC:L/AT:N/PR:L/UI:N/VC:H/VI:H/VA:H/SC:N/SI:N/SA:N/E:U/U:Green


The vulnerability allows a remote attacker to execute arbitrary shell commands on the target system.

The vulnerability exists due to improper neutralization of special elements in the CGI program. A remote user can pass specially crafted data to the application and execute arbitrary OS commands on the target system.

Successful exploitation of this vulnerability may result in complete compromise of vulnerable system.


4) OS Command Injection (CVE-ID: CVE-2023-37928)

CWE-ID: CWE-78 - Improper Neutralization of Special Elements used in an OS Command ('OS Command Injection')

CVSSv4: CVSS:4.0/AV:N/AC:L/AT:N/PR:L/UI:N/VC:H/VI:H/VA:H/SC:N/SI:N/SA:N/E:U/U:Green


The vulnerability allows a remote attacker to execute arbitrary shell commands on the target system.

The vulnerability exists due to improper input validation in the WSGI server. A remote user can pass specially crafted data to the application and execute arbitrary OS commands on the target system.

Successful exploitation of this vulnerability may result in complete compromise of vulnerable system.


5) OS Command Injection (CVE-ID: CVE-2023-4473)

CWE-ID: CWE-78 - Improper Neutralization of Special Elements used in an OS Command ('OS Command Injection')

CVSSv4: CVSS:4.0/AV:N/AC:L/AT:N/PR:N/UI:N/VC:H/VI:H/VA:H/SC:N/SI:N/SA:N/E:U/U:Amber


The vulnerability allows a remote attacker to execute arbitrary shell commands on the target system.

The vulnerability exists due to improper input validation in the web server. A remote unauthenticated attacker can pass specially crafted data to the application and execute arbitrary OS commands on the target system.

Successful exploitation of this vulnerability may result in complete compromise of vulnerable system.


6) Improper Neutralization of Special Elements in Output Used by a Downstream Component (CVE-ID: CVE-2023-4474)

CWE-ID: CWE-74 - Improper Neutralization of Special Elements in Output Used by a Downstream Component ('Injection')

CVSSv4: CVSS:4.0/AV:N/AC:L/AT:N/PR:N/UI:N/VC:H/VI:H/VA:H/SC:N/SI:N/SA:N/E:U/U:Amber


The vulnerability allows a remote attacker to execute arbitrary shell commands on the target system.

The vulnerability exists due to improper neutralization of special elements in the WSGI server. A remote user can pass specially crafted data to the application and execute arbitrary OS commands on the target system.

Successful exploitation of this vulnerability may result in complete compromise of vulnerable system.
